This past Saturday we ventured over to the Singapore Zoo. It was hands down the best zoo either of us has ever been to! Similar to the Night Safari, the zoo has a totally open concept allowing you to get right up next to the animals without actually disturbing them (the barriers are invisible in most cases). Plus, most of the exhibits are set up in such a way that the animals can't completely hide themselves from the public view...that makes the trip to the zoo worth every penny! Our morning started with a "Jungle Breakfast" where we helped ourselves to a huge spread of food and dined right alongside several orangutans! They were literally right next to our table and while we weren't allowed to touch them, we were allowed to stand right next to them. The pictures below totally speak for themselves (although I speak for them too since I can't help but make comments!) on how much fun the experience was! Once we were finished with breakfast, we walked through the zoo seeing all kinds of animals close up! We stood face to face with giraffes, watched monkeys swinging on trees right above us, got so close to the zebras we could practically touch them and saw the best elephant show I have ever seen!
